Section 61G15-24.001 - Schedule of Fees

Universal Citation: FL Admin Code R 61G15-24.001

Current through Reg. 50, No. 249, December 24, 2024

(1) Pursuant to Section 471.011, F.S., the Board hereby establishes the following fees for applications, licensing and renewal, temporary registration, late renewal, licensure by endorsement, reactivation fee, and replacement of certificate.

(2) Engineering licensure fees (individuals and firms):

(a) Application fee for licensure by examination or endorsement - $125.00 non-refundable.

(b) Initial license fee - $100.00.

(c) Biennial renewal fee - $93.75.

(d) Delinquency fee - $25.00.

(e) Temporary license (individual) - $25.00.

(f) Temporary license (qualified business organization) - $50.00.

(g) Reinstatement fee - $150.00.

(h) Inactive Status fee - $125.00.

(i) Reactivation fee - $150.00.

(j) Change of Status fee (Active/Inactive) - $93.75.

(k) Duplicate Certificate - $25.00.

(l) Special Inspector Certification fee - $100.00.

(m) Application fee for Special Inspector Certification - $125.00.

(n) Engineer Intern Endorsement fee - $100.00.

(3) Engineer Intern application fee - $30.00.

(4) Continuing Education provider fees:

Application fee for continuing education provider status - $250.00.

(5) Unlicensed Activity Fee collected by the Department of Business and Professional Regulation pursuant to Section 455.2281, F.S. - $5.00.

Rulemaking Authority 455.213, 455.2179(3), 455.219, 455.271, 471.008, 471.011 FS. Law Implemented 455.217(3), (7), 455.2179(3), 471.011, 471.015, 471.021 FS.

New 1-8-80, Amended 8-26-81, 12-19-82, 6-2-83, 2-28-84, Formerly 21H-24.01, Amended 3-10-86, 12-11-86, 3-10-87, 4-12-88, 12-21-88, 1-10-90, 8-15-90, 1-6-93, Formerly 21H-24.001, Amended 11-15-94, 8-10-98, 6-16-99, 5-8-00, 11-15-01, 2-21-02, 9-16-02, 5-9-04, 6-5-05, 3-5-06, 7-17-14, 3-29-17, 10-30-17, 8-8-18, 12-29-19.
